Transforming the Future of Elections with Vehicle-to-Grid Microgrids

Introduction: As we move towards a greener and more sustainable future, innovative technologies are revolutionizing various sectors, including the way we conduct elections. One such technology that holds tremendous potential is the concept of vehicle-to-grid microgrids. In this blog post, we will explore how vehicle-to-grid microgrids can transform the future of elections, providing a cleaner, more reliable, and inclusive electoral process. 1. What are Vehicle-to-Grid Microgrids? Vehicle-to-grid (V2G) technology allows electric vehicles (EVs) to transfer excess power back to the grid when not in use. Coupled with the concept of microgrids - localized energy systems that can disconnect from the main grid - V2G microgrids can enable more sustainable and resilient power supply to various applications, including election processes. 2. Enhancing Resilience and Reliability: During elections, it is crucial to ensure a reliable and uninterruptable power supply to voting centers, ballot counting facilities, and electronic voting machines. V2G microgrids can significantly enhance the resilience and reliability of the power infrastructure, mitigating the risks of power outages and ensuring a smooth and uninterrupted electoral process. 3. Reducing Emissions and Environmental Impact: Traditional methods of generating electricity for election processes often rely on fossil fuels, contributing to greenhouse gas emissions and pollution. By integrating V2G microgrids into the election infrastructure, we can harness the power of renewable energy sources, such as solar and wind, stored in EVs' batteries. This not only reduces carbon emissions but also helps in achieving sustainability goals. 4. Increased Accessibility and Inclusivity: One of the major challenges during elections is providing access to remote or underserved areas. V2G microgrids, coupled with the growing adoption of EVs, can offer a solution to this problem. EVs can act as mobile power sources, delivering electricity to areas lacking proper grid infrastructure, thereby ensuring a more inclusive and accessible voting process. 5. Lowering Costs and Generating Revenue: V2G microgrids can also provide financial benefits to the election organizers. By utilizing the stored energy in EVs, it becomes possible to offset peak demand charges, leading to cost savings. Additionally, excess power fed back to the grid can be used to generate revenue through grid services, enabling the election infrastructure to become financially self-sustainable. 6. Overcoming Challenges and Adoption Roadmap: While the potential of V2G microgrids in the election process is immense, several challenges need to be addressed. These include standardization, cybersecurity, and developing appropriate policies and regulations. Collaboration between public and private stakeholders, as well as research and development efforts, will play a crucial role in overcoming these challenges and accelerating the adoption of this innovative technology. Conclusion: As the world looks for ways to create a sustainable and democratic future, vehicle-to-grid microgrids present an exciting opportunity to transform the way we conduct elections. By implementing this technology, we can enhance resilience, reduce emissions, increase accessibility, and lower costs, ultimately creating a more inclusive and eco-friendly electoral process.
